The pharmaceutical industry is one of the largest and most influential segments driving the demand for clean room technologies in the Asia Pacific region. With increasing regulatory requirements for manufacturing sterile drugs and biologics, pharmaceutical companies must ensure their facilities adhere to stringent cleanliness standards to avoid contamination. Clean rooms in the pharmaceutical industry are used for processes such as the production of vaccines, tablets, and injectable medications. The primary function of these controlled environments is to minimize microbial contamination, particulate matter, and other contaminants, ensuring that pharmaceuticals meet safety standards and regulatory requirements. As a result, the market for clean room technologies in this sector is expected to continue growing at a significant pace, fueled by the increasing demand for pharmaceutical products, especially in emerging economies within Asia Pacific.
The application of clean room technologies in the pharmaceutical industry goes beyond the production stage and extends into testing, packaging, and distribution. The need for contamination control is critical in all stages of drug development and manufacturing. Clean rooms provide an environment where cross-contamination risks are minimized, making them essential for the development of new and more complex medicines. Additionally, the growth of the Asia Pacific pharmaceutical market, coupled with the rising number of pharmaceutical companies expanding operations in the region, further bolsters the demand for state-of-the-art clean room technology. Innovations such as modular clean room systems and real-time monitoring of air quality are also contributing to the overall growth and efficiency of these pharmaceutical manufacturing environments.
The biotechnology industry also significantly benefits from the use of clean room technologies. Biotechnology companies, particularly those involved in the development and manufacturing of biologics, require highly controlled environments to avoid contamination during the production of their products. This includes gene therapies, monoclonal antibodies, and other biologics that require strict environmental control for successful manufacturing. Clean rooms in the biotechnology industry ensure that biological products are not compromised by particulate or microbial contamination, which could otherwise lead to severe health risks or the failure of a product during clinical trials. The demand for clean room technology in biotechnology is accelerating as advancements in biotechnology continue to expand the range of products and treatments available in the market.
Furthermore, the increasing prevalence of personalized medicine and the expansion of biotechnology research and development in the Asia Pacific region is driving demand for clean room technologies. As companies move toward more complex and sensitive biologics, the need for clean rooms that can meet high standards of contamination control is critical. Clean rooms also play an important role in ensuring that these advanced biotech products meet regulatory compliance standards, which vary from country to country. As Asia Pacific continues to be a hub for biotech innovation and clinical trials, the clean room technology market within this sector is expected to grow considerably, offering new opportunities for market participants.
Medical device manufacturers require clean room environments to meet the stringent quality and safety standards imposed by regulatory authorities. Devices such as surgical instruments, implants, and diagnostic equipment must be free from contamination to ensure they are safe for use in medical procedures. Clean rooms provide the necessary environment to prevent contamination during the manufacturing process, ensuring that medical devices meet both performance and safety criteria. Contamination during the production of medical devices can lead to significant risks, including product recalls, safety issues, and financial loss. As the medical device industry continues to grow, particularly in the Asia Pacific region, the demand for clean room technology in manufacturing processes is expected to rise.
The clean room technology market for medical device manufacturers is also driven by the increasing complexity of medical devices, which often incorporate advanced materials and technologies. As the medical device industry becomes more sophisticated, the need for precision in the manufacturing environment becomes even more critical. Moreover, increasing investments in healthcare infrastructure in Asia Pacific countries, along with the growth of local medical device manufacturing, is contributing to the market’s expansion. With rising demand for innovative medical devices across emerging markets, the role of clean rooms in maintaining product quality and ensuring compliance with regulatory standards becomes even more essential for manufacturers.
Hospitals are key end-users of clean room technologies, particularly in departments like surgery, pharmaceutical compounding, and diagnostic laboratories. Clean rooms within hospital settings are essential for preventing infections, especially in high-risk areas such as operating rooms, intensive care units (ICUs), and specialized treatment areas. Clean room technologies are used to control air quality, temperature, humidity, and particulate levels, creating a sterile environment that is crucial for patient safety. In addition to reducing the risk of healthcare-associated infections, clean rooms help hospitals meet the hygiene standards required by various regulatory bodies, ensuring that hospital facilities provide a safe and sterile environment for both patients and staff.
As hospitals continue to adopt more advanced technologies and treatments, the need for clean room environments is expanding. Hospitals in the Asia Pacific region are increasingly investing in modern clean room systems to ensure that they comply with global healthcare standards and provide the best possible outcomes for patients. Additionally, the rise of outpatient surgical centers, medical research, and advanced diagnostic laboratories is driving the adoption of clean room technologies in healthcare facilities. The ongoing developments in hospital infrastructure and the growing focus on patient safety and infection prevention are expected to continue fueling demand for clean room technologies in hospitals across the region.
Several key trends are shaping the clean room technology market in the Asia Pacific region. One of the most notable trends is the increasing adoption of modular clean room designs, which allow for more flexible, scalable, and cost-effective solutions. These modular systems are particularly beneficial for industries like pharmaceuticals and biotechnology, where changing production needs may require alterations to the clean room configuration. Additionally, there is growing interest in the integration of advanced technologies such as real-time environmental monitoring systems and automation to improve efficiency, reduce human error, and ensure the continuous maintenance of clean room conditions. With the rise of Industry 4.0, the clean room sector is becoming more digitized, offering innovative solutions that allow for better data management, predictive maintenance, and compliance tracking.
